Job Description

Lead the development of high performance backend services for GM Commercial Services while driving technical standards across the organization.

Responsibilities

  • Provide technical leadership for the design and delivery of the flagship GM Commercial Services software
  • Develop a deep understanding of GM Commercial Services business strategy and goals
  • Take a big-picture view to find inefficiencies and identify meaningful improvement opportunities across the organization
  • Drive alignment on approaches and lead delivery of high leverage solutions with the widest impact
  • Raise engineering quality across the team by improving best practices and producing exemplary code, documentation, automated tests, and thorough monitoring
  • Build and launch new products that deliver significant value to internal and external customers
  • Coll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ders including dependency engineering teams, product, design, infrastructure, and operations
  • Mentor junior and experienced engineers to support technical career growth

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ience designing and building large engineering projects, including productionization of scalable, reliable, performant systems
  • Extensive experience with architecture and design including architecture, design patterns, reliability, and scaling for new and existing systems
  • Extensive experience with Java / Kotlin or Python
  • Experience with SQL and NoSQL databases
  • Experience with at least one public cloud provider: Azure, AWS, or GCP
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work in an agile development environment
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ills and a collaborative mindset
  • Knowledge of software design patterns, object-oriented programming (OO), data structures, and algorithms
  • Passion for staying current with industry trends and technologies
  • Strong product focus and acumen
  • Experience with project management to ensure on-time team deliverables with high quality
  • Experience with Databricks
  • Experience with React and modern JavaScript libraries, plus HTML and CSS

Compensation

  • Salary range: USD 153,200 - 269,100 per year
  • Bonus potential: incentive pay program with payouts based on company performance, job level, and individual performance
